From 75804df1cb231033f94183e41cdf79d36d8f6710 Mon Sep 17 00:00:00 2001 From: Joris Date: Sun, 21 Aug 2016 14:30:40 +0200 Subject: Show a message if there is an error during a server request --- src/client/elm/Dialog/AddIncome/View.elm | 10 +++++----- src/client/elm/Dialog/AddPayment/View.elm | 10 +++++----- 2 files changed, 10 insertions(+), 10 deletions(-) (limited to 'src/client/elm/Dialog') diff --git a/src/client/elm/Dialog/AddIncome/View.elm b/src/client/elm/Dialog/AddIncome/View.elm index cc1ac13..c628d37 100644 --- a/src/client/elm/Dialog/AddIncome/View.elm +++ b/src/client/elm/Dialog/AddIncome/View.elm @@ -35,11 +35,11 @@ button : String -> LoggedData -> List (String, Field) -> String -> Html Msg -> M button className loggedData initialForm title buttonContent tooltip = let dialogConfig = { className = "incomeDialog" - , title = getMessage title loggedData.translations + , title = getMessage loggedData.translations title , body = \model -> addIncomeForm loggedData model.addIncome - , confirm = getMessage "Confirm" loggedData.translations + , confirm = getMessage loggedData.translations "Confirm" , confirmMsg = submitForm << .addIncome - , undo = getMessage "Undo" loggedData.translations + , undo = getMessage loggedData.translations "Undo" } in Html.button ( ( case tooltip of @@ -68,8 +68,8 @@ submitForm addIncome = Just data -> case data.id of Just incomeId -> - Msg.Dialog <| Dialog.UpdateAndClose <| Msg.UpdateLoggedIn <| LoggedInMsg.EditIncome incomeId data.amount data.date + Msg.Dialog <| Dialog.UpdateAndClose <| Msg.EditIncome incomeId data.amount data.date Nothing -> - Msg.Dialog <| Dialog.UpdateAndClose <| Msg.UpdateLoggedIn <| LoggedInMsg.CreateIncome data.amount data.date + Msg.Dialog <| Dialog.UpdateAndClose <| Msg.CreateIncome data.amount data.date Nothing -> Msg.Dialog <| Dialog.Update <| DialogMsg.AddIncomeMsg <| Form.Submit diff --git a/src/client/elm/Dialog/AddPayment/View.elm b/src/client/elm/Dialog/AddPayment/View.elm index 3ffe200..df1ad3b 100644 --- a/src/client/elm/Dialog/AddPayment/View.elm +++ b/src/client/elm/Dialog/AddPayment/View.elm @@ -36,11 +36,11 @@ button : LoggedData -> List (String, Field) -> String -> Html Msg -> Maybe Strin button loggedData initialForm title buttonContent tooltip = let dialogConfig = { className = "paymentDialog" - , title = getMessage title loggedData.translations + , title = getMessage loggedData.translations title , body = \model -> addPaymentForm loggedData model.addPayment - , confirm = getMessage "Confirm" loggedData.translations + , confirm = getMessage loggedData.translations "Confirm" , confirmMsg = submitForm << .addPayment - , undo = getMessage "Undo" loggedData.translations + , undo = getMessage loggedData.translations "Undo" } in Html.button ( ( case tooltip of @@ -75,8 +75,8 @@ submitForm addPayment = Just data -> case data.id of Just paymentId -> - Msg.Dialog <| Dialog.UpdateAndClose <| Msg.UpdateLoggedIn <| LoggedInMsg.EditPayment paymentId data.name data.cost data.date data.frequency + Msg.Dialog <| Dialog.UpdateAndClose <| Msg.EditPayment paymentId data.name data.cost data.date data.frequency Nothing -> - Msg.Dialog <| Dialog.UpdateAndClose <| Msg.UpdateLoggedIn <| LoggedInMsg.CreatePayment data.name data.cost data.date data.frequency + Msg.Dialog <| Dialog.UpdateAndClose <| Msg.CreatePayment data.name data.cost data.date data.frequency Nothing -> Msg.Dialog <| Dialog.Update <| DialogMsg.AddPaymentMsg <| Form.Submit -- cgit v1.2.3